Originally Posted by Ajh800
which good quality tyres would you recommend, or short list? I'm tempted to go from 25mm to 28mm, comfort is important and any advice would be appreciated.
Wilfrid Laurier is exactly right. FWIW, suggestions:

1. Fast/light on-road: Specialized Roubaix Pro (the new/current ones) in 25/28 or 30/32, or
2. Conti GP4000 in 28; or
3. Compass tires Compass Bicycles: 700C Tires
4. Lightish/quick on-road and usable on dirt/gravel: Panaracer Pasela TG folding (32), or whatever Panaracer is calling 'em now.
